A sportsbook is a gambling establishment that accepts wagers on various sporting events. Aside from offering lines on teams and individual players, they also offer odds that let bettors determine the likelihood of an event occurring. The higher the probability of an event happening, the lower the payout. This way, bettors can balance risk and reward and make smarter betting decisions.

Sportsbook software has a variety of features and settings that allow bettors to customize their experience. These include filtering options, allowing users to place bets on their favorite teams and leagues, and creating an engaging user experience. These elements can be a huge part of attracting and retaining sportsbook users.

The best ways to ensure that your sportsbook is a success are to focus on the customer experience, develop an engaging mobile app, and provide a variety of betting options. By doing so, you will create a more immersive and exciting betting experience for your customers, which will increase your profits and keep them coming back for more.

Many large sports betting websites are constrained in what they can offer their users because they have to consider investors and large operational expenses. This is one reason why pay per head bookie solutions are so popular, as they can be much more responsive to each sports fan that uses their service.

Lastly, you should always be aware of the legalities and regulations surrounding your sportsbook. These will vary by jurisdiction, but they will likely include responsible gambling, age restrictions, and other safeguards. Keeping these in mind will help you avoid any potential issues down the road and protect your business from lawsuits.